Petitioner wrote of Jeong-hee Yoon, “Alone in an apartment outside Paris without being cared for by a spouse in a state of separation from her husband, suffering from Alzheimer’s disease and diabetes.” In addition, he argued, “Although my daughter lives nearby, I can’t take care of my mother properly because my life is busy due to work and family life. I can’t go out alone and live like a prison.”
On the 7th, Paik Kun-woo’s Korean performance agency Vinche-ro issued an admission statement, “Since a few years ago, Yoon Jeong-hee’s health was rapidly deteriorating and he could not accompany him.” He explained that it is possible to live under the care of a caregiver designated by him.
After Yoon Jeong-hee traveled to Paris in May 2019, his brothers and sisters filed a lawsuit over the appointment and method of guardianship. It filed an objection to the Parisian District Court in France for designating Baek and his daughter Jin-hee as the guardians of Yun’s property and personal life, but said that the brothers and sisters had finally lost due to a ruling by the Paris High Court in November of last year.
At the time of the lawsuit, Yun’s younger brothers claimed that “the two could not provide adequate care to Yun and were suspected of financial embezzlement,” but the French court did not accept it. Some view this petition as an extension of that or a problem surrounding Yoon’s inheritance problem.

Yoon Jung-hee was called’Actress Troika’ along with Moon-hee and Nam Jeong-im in the 1960s. He married Baek in 1976 and moved to France to live.
Yoon Jung-hee’s last film, who appeared in 320 films, is the 2010 film’Poetry’ by Lee Chang-dong. In this film, Jung-hee Yoon played’Mi-ja,’ a grandmother who raises a grandson alone and learns poetry at a late age, and swept the Best Actress Award at a domestic film awards ceremony. She stepped on the red carpet at the Cannes Film Festival and won the LA Critics Association Award for Best Actress.
‘Mija’ was a role that suffered from early symptoms of Alzheimer’s. It is known that the work was written by director Chang-dong Lee with Yoon Jung-hee in mind. The name Mija is Yoon Jung-hee’s real name.
